Carlos Alcaraz (Spain) has clinched the men’s singles Madrid Open title 2022 after beating the defending champion Alexander Zverev (Germany). Alcaraz has also defeated Rafael Nadal and Novak Djokovic (world No.1) to reach the final. It is his second Masters 1000 crown after Miami 2022 and his fourth title of the year.

Ons Jabeur (Tunisia) has clinched the women’s singles title to become the first African player to win a WTA 1000 event.
Here are the winners of different categories:
| Category | Winner |
| Men’s singles: | Carlos Alcaraz (Spain) |
| Women’s singles: | Ons Jabeur (Tunisia) |
| Men’s doubles: | Wesley Koolhof (Netherlands) & Neal Skupski (United Kingdom) |
| Women’s doubles: | Gabriela Dabrowski (Canada) & Giuliana Olmos (Mexico) |
